- Sinai Health researchers published a BMJ study identifying 24 common "prescribing cascades" — medication chains where a drug's side effect triggers an unnecessary follow-up prescription, citing NSAIDs that raise blood pressure and statins among the drugs involved.
- Dr. Paula Rochon, Director of Research at Sinai Health's Weston and O'Born Center for Mature Women's Health, led the population-level analysis using Ontario prescription data from ICES, narrowing 65 candidate cascades flagged by 12 international panelists down to 24 with measurable real-world impact.
- Older adults are the most exposed population because they typically manage multiple chronic conditions and take several drugs at once, making it difficult for clinicians and patients to tell whether a new symptom stems from an existing medication.
- Mature women face elevated risk because women tend to have more chronic conditions, receive more drug therapies, and experience more adverse drug events across their lifetimes than men, the researchers found.
- An international research team — collaborators from the US, Belgium, Italy, Israel, and Ireland — recommends automated clinical decision support systems that flag when a new prescription appears to address a known side effect of an existing drug.
- Greater pharmacist involvement in prescribing decisions could surface cascade patterns that busy physicians miss, giving clinicians a chance to reconsider the original treatment rather than add another medication.
Why it matters: With 24 prescribing cascades now mapped against real-world Ontario prescription data, the study gives clinicians a concrete checklist for medication reviews and gives automated decision-support systems a defined set of patterns to flag at the point of prescribing. Older adults and mature women, identified by the researchers as the most exposed, face avoidable drug burden when these cascades go unrecognized.
